Photovoltaic panel glass can withstand hail

Photovoltaic panel glass can withstand hail

Solar panels, with thick tempered glass, can endure hail diameters from 1 to 1. 75 inches, propelled at speeds of 25 to 40 mph, and typically withstand severe hailstorms. Hail sizes exceeding 2 inches can damage solar panels.

Are photovoltaic panels glass surfaces

Are photovoltaic panels glass surfaces

Glass used in solar panels is primarily low-iron tempered glass, with a thickness typically between 3 to 6 millimeters, ensuring optimal light transmittance and durability.
